That's why you need to get spinning with our ingenious Candy Floss Maker. With this idiot-proof contraption you'll be making funfair-style candy floss in minutes. Simply add regular caster sugar and switch it on. That's all there is to it. Well, almost.
As the machine heats up, the central head begins to spin, forcing liquid sugar through its tiny perforations. The instant the threads of sugar hit the air they cool and re-solidify, causing a web of sugary threads to develop in the dishwasher-friendly collection bowl. All you have to do is gather up the yummy wisps on your candy floss cone and get munching. The whole process is really rather wondrous.
